Understanding Trauma-Informed Care
Trauma-informed care is an approach in mental health that acknowledges the widespread impact of trauma and understands potential paths for recovery. It recognizes the signs and symptoms of trauma in clients, families, staff, and others involved with the mental health system. More importantly, this approach actively seeks to resist re-traumatization. For the transgender community, this means creating a safe, affirming space where individuals feel respected and valued.
Key Principles of Our Approach:
- Acknowledgment of the prevalence and impact of trauma
- Recognition of the signs and symptoms of trauma
- Integration of knowledge about trauma into policies, procedures, and practices
- Avoidance of re-traumatization
